EC sets aviation carbon limit at 213MT for 2012

March 9, 2011 |

In Belgium, the European Commission has determined that average carbon emissions between 2004 and 2006 for airline flights reached 219 million metric tons and will therefore grant just under 213 million tons of allowances for 2012. Allowances will then fall to about 208.5 million tons every year after. The airline industry is required to participate in the European Emissions Trading Scheme beginning in 2012.
